Job Description:
The DeFi Product Manager is responsible for designing,
evaluating, and scaling institutional-grade DeFi investment
products, with a primary focus on protocol assessment, vault
construction, and ongoing portfolio curation. This role sits at the
intersection of traditional capital markets, investment risk
management, and on-chain financial infrastructure, translating DeFi
primitives into investable, co mpliant, and risk-managed products
for investors. The role requires deep technical fluency in
blockchain and smart-contract systems, strong investment judgment
grounded in traditional finance, and extensive operating
relationships across the DeFi ecosystem. The successful candidate
will combine the judgment of a seasoned investment professional
with the technical fluency of a DeFi native. They will be capable
of structuring differentiated on-chain products, identifying and
mitigating risk before it materializes, and serving as a credible
bridge between traditional investment managers and the DeFi
ecosystem. Duties DeFi Protocol Evaluation & Due Diligence • Lead
comprehensive due diligence of DeFi protocols, including: •
Smart-contract architecture and upgradeability models • Economic
and incentive design (tokenomics, liquidity dynamics, fee
structures) • Governance frameworks and decentralization maturity •
Oracle dependencies, cross-chain risk, and composability exposure •
Assess protocol risk across market, liquidity, counterparty,
technical, and governance dimensions. • Maintain a living protocol
risk taxonomy and scoring framework aligned with institutional risk
standards. Vault Design, Construction & Curation • Design and
launch on-chain vaults and structured DeFi strategies (e.g., yield,
carry, delta-neutral, liquidity provision, structured credit). •
Curate vault parameters including asset eligibility, allocation
limits, rebalancing logic, and risk constraints. • Oversee ongoing
vault monitoring, performance attribution, and risk reporting. •
Work closely with engineering teams to translate investment logic
into smart-contract-enforced rules. Investment & Risk Management
Integration • Apply traditional portfolio construction, risk
budgeting, and capital markets frameworks to on-chain strategies. •
Define stress testing, scenario analysis, and drawdown management
approaches for DeFi portfolios. • Partner with legal, compliance,
and operations teams to ensure products meet institutional
governance and fiduciary expectations. • Support investment
committee materials, protocol memos, and board-level product
reviews. Ecosystem Engagement & Product Sourcing • Maintain deep,
active relationships across the DeFi ecosystem, including protocol
founders, core developers, DAO contributors, auditors, and
infrastructure providers. • Source early-stage protocol
opportunities and influence roadmap discussions relevant to
institutional use cases. • Represent the firm in DeFi governance
forums, working groups, and industry initiatives. • Monitor
emerging DeFi primitives, L2s, app-chains, restaking, and
cross-chain infrastructure relevant to vault strategies. The

background in computer science or engineering. The Team Fidelity
Digital Asset Management (FDAM) is Fidelity Investments’ digital
asset investment platform, offering products and services designed
to meet the needs of retail, intermediary, and institutional
clients. As part of the Asset Management division, FDAM brings
Fidelity’s research-led investment culture to digital
assets—evaluating opportunities across the ecosystem and building
client-focused investment solutions. FDAM is a well-resourced team
with support from Asset Management and the broader Fidelity
enterprise, driving the development of critical digital asset
infrastructure for the firm. We foster an entrepreneurial culture
that leverages the latest technologies to create new products and
capabilities, integrating traditional and on-chain markets to
deliver innovative solutions for investors.
